School of Magical Animals 3

Released: 2024-09-26
Revenue 25000869
Homepage: https://epsilonfilm.de/title/school-of-magical-animals-3
Studios: Kordes & Kordes Film, Leonine Studios,


Ida wants to perform with her class at the annual Forest Day to campaign for the protection of the local forest. Even Helene is there, as she hopes to use the footage of the performance to build up her influencer channel. What nobody knows is that Helene's family is on the verge of bankruptcy and Helene urgently needs followers to avert the threat of bankruptcy. Helene is also under pressure from the high expectations of her magical animal, Karajan the cat from Paris, who imagines a life of pure luxury.
